8 States Now Say Complete Ban on Gas-Powered New Car Sales Coming

The war on gas-powered vehicles continues.

While the White House recently released new rules to phase out gas-powered vehicles by 2032, several states have gone further.

Eight states plan to completely ban the sale of new gas-powered cars by 2035, the U.K.’s Daily Mail reported. Who’s leading the charge, you might ask?

Why, it’s California, of course!

They are joined by Rhode Island, Maryland, Massachusetts, New Jersey, New York, Oregon, and Washington. Washington, D.C., has also committed to the ban, according to Money.

If you live in one of these states, you won’t be forced to take your gas-powered car off the road and can still buy these automobiles used or secondhand.
